Jamshedpur FC Hold Mohun Bagan SG to 1-1 Draw, Extend Unbeaten Streak to Four Matches

On January 17, Jamshedpur FC hosted Mohun Bagan SG and extended their three-match unbeaten streak in the ongoing Indian Super League, with a second-half equaliser to end the match 1-1. The Man of the Match, Stephen Eze, scored the only on-target strike for the Red Miners and displayed a strong defensive performance to hold the defending Shield champions.

From the kickoff, Mohun Bagan SG started dominating the match with maximum ball possession and back-to-back attacks. In the 25th minute, from a corner kick, Cummins delivered the ball, which Aldred headed down to Subhasis, who, from close range, placed the ball into the net to bring the lead.

In the 36th minute, Cummins made a solo long run with the ball and, from the edge of the box, attempted a shot. With a last-ditch defensive effort, Eze extended his body and used his leg to block the shot. In the first half, the Red Miners didn’t attempt a single shot on target and took only two shots.

From the start of the second half, Mohun Bagan SG continued their game where they left off. From the right, Cummins delivered an inch-perfect cross towards the far post for Maclaren, from the close range, he didn’t make proper contact with the ball, which deflected off the bottom corner of the post.

In the 60th minute, Jamshedpur FC found their equaliser. From midfield, Eze started an unmarked run, went inside the box between three players, he unleashed a precise long shot into the net. He brilliantly brings a point for his team and sealed the scoreline.

Jamshedpur FC celebrating after scoring against Mohun Bagan SG

The match slowed down after that, however, Mohun Bagan SG resumed their attacks, but Jamshedpur FC’s defense remained alert. In the 81st minute, Petratos replaced Maclaren, and within four minutes, from the right, Dimi Petratos pulled back a ball for Liston Colaco, who took a shot from the edge of the box, which the keeper saved by inches.

Throughout the match, Mohun Bagan showcased a dominant performance with 57% ball possession and attempted 20 shots. On the other hand, the hosts managed only 9 shots, with just one on target. However, their defensive resilience maintained the equalised scoreline, moving them to the second spot in the group table with 28 points from 15 matches. The defending Shield champions remained on top with 36 points from 16 matches.

UPCOMING FIXTURES: Jamshedpur FC have their next away fixtures against Hyderabad FC on January 23. Mohun Bagan SG will play their next away fixtures on January 21, against Chennaiyin FC.
